Santa Clara Shakes as Earthquake Strikes Ahead of the Big Game
The anticipation for Super Bowl 60 between the Seattle Seahawks and New England Patriots was already high, but on Monday morning, a 4.2 earthquake added an unexpected twist. The tremors, which began with a 3.9 quake at 6:27 a.m. PT, were felt across Santa Clara, according to ESPN's Jeff Darlington. This wasn't an isolated incident; the area has experienced multiple tremor strings in recent months, as noted by ABC 7 News.
The Patriots and Seahawks will face off at Levi's Stadium, home of the San Francisco 49ers, on Sunday. Both teams boast impressive 14-3 records this season, making this a highly anticipated match-up.
